Challenges of Packaging Drink Powder in Stick Packs and Sachets

While convenience and portion control are key factors for stick packs and sachets, the packaging process presents unique challenges.

With reference to the hygroscopic nature of the drink powders, packaging materials should protect the product from moisture. For this reason, moisture-proof laminates are essential to prevent this.
Moreover, packaging materials with a good barrier against light and oxygen are crucial. Both light and oxygen can affect the taste of the drink powder dosed inside the sachets and stick packs.

Regarding the filling and sealing process, there are some key points to highlight when designing a packaging machine.
Powders can have variable flow properties. For this reason, we analyze every drink powder to highlight their physical characteristics, in order to optimize machine design and dosing system.
In addition, the scientific study of the laminate is vital to design the most efficient sealing unit according to its physical characteristics. Strong seals are crucial to prevent leaks and ensure product integrity.

To conclude, there are several issues to consider for the packaging of drink powder in sachets and sticks. Laminate characteristics, dosing system and sealing technologies are key points before and during machine design. An optimized design of the sachet or stick pack machine can ensure product quality, convenience and sustainability.
